Hi folks
I noticed that the valve stem on the 3rd valve of my Conn V1 is losing it's silver plate (it just seems to be flaking off). Does anyone know where I can get a set of stems? - in silver preferably.
many thanks in advance

Brian,
I had the same problem with my V1, except the stems were lacquer and not silverplate. I went to the closest UMI dealer and special ordered new set of goldplated stems and buttons. It may take a while to get the set, and was a little pricey for my tastes, but man do they look good! I think most band instrument stores have a UMI catalog they can order them out of, if your's doesn't, you can always order from Hickey's music online. Just call and ask for Dave Zimet. Hope this helps!
